In Günzburg, a town in Bavaria, stands a historic building that once served as a hospitium of a monastery and now accommodates a mix of residential and commercial spaces. This structure is a testament to the region's monastic past and is a protected monument.
History+
The building's origins lie in its function as a hospitium, a guesthouse that belonged to a monastery. Such facilities were common in the Middle Ages and early modern period, providing accommodation for travelers, pilgrims, or even the sick and needy. Over time, its use changed, and the former hospitium was converted into a residential and commercial building, while its historical fabric was preserved.

Today, the former monastic hospitium serves as a residential and commercial building. It is designated as a listed building in Bavaria, which underscores its historical value and architectural significance and ensures its protection.
